We know, we know... THE SNOW! What great timing for it to finally show up with just 9 DAYS before the season ends! This is just a reminder that ultimately THE LOCAL CLUB in the area is to decide whether their trails are open or not. With the unprecedented winter, MANY trail signs have been removed due to water hazards and farmers starting to work their fields. If signs have been removed, there is most likely a reason and the trail is CLOSED. Over 20,000 miles of our 22,000 miles of trails are on privately owned land, and it is in the local clubs best interest to protect that property to retain use of the land. We would like to think that should be EVERYONE's best interest.

Go out and have fun these last few days! Just please follow marked trails and check with your local clubs to know where you can ride first!

🚨ENDANGERED TRAIL ALERT🚨

Some of you know that we lost access to the trail along Centennial Drive, in the field north of the HWY 27 crossing, and the field just north of 153rd Street. This was due to riders not staying on the trail and choosing to ride down the farm road into town. We have been working with the property owners who have agreed to let us back on their property, as long as we respect it. Trails are a privilege not a right.

The blue line shown below is the snowmobile trail. We are NOT allowed to ride across the field from 1st Ave West to Centennial Drive (marked in red). If we do, we will lose all of the trail.

Please use the marked trail to get into town. The club has worked hard to get this back so let’s all do our part to respect the property owners. STAY ON THE TRAIL OR STAY HOME!
